Ingredients

  • 40 gram Low fat margarine

  • 0.33 Caster sugar -(or natural sweetener like Natvia/Stevia)

  • 2 tsp Orange rind-finely grated

  • 0.75 cup Low fat milk

  • 2 Eggs-separated

  • 0.33 gram Self raising flour

  • 0.33 cup orange juice

  • 2 gram Icing sugar-for dusting

Directions

  • Preheat the oven to 180 degrees or 160 for fan forced. Spray with oil in four ramekins.
  • Beat the sugar, margarine and rind until fluffy and then add egg yolks, 1 at a time. Beat well after each egg yolk.
  • Fold in the flour, milk and juice in 2 goes.
  • Beat egg whites in a clean, dry bowl until soft peaks form. Then very gently fold the orange mixture into the egg whites.
  • Divide mixture between dishes and bake for 20 to 25 minutes. They should be puffed up and golden.

Notes

  • Not suitable for freezing.
  • To serve dust with icing sugar
